Methods

  • Current Methods
    • Sensitive species monitoring
      • Started: 1990-08-01
      • Method Description: Native plant species known to be senstive to ozone and reliable bioindicators of ozone injury, are monitored annually to determine the presence/absence of injury on up to 10 individuals per species.

    • Species monitored
      • Started: 1991-08-01
      • Method Description: Species monitored include milkweed, blackberry, black cherry and white ash.

    • Voucher specimens
      • Started: 1993-08-01
      • Method Description: Voucher specimens sent to regional expert for verification.

    • Species evaluation
      • Started: 1994-08-01
      • Method Description: Starting in 1994, 10 - 30 individuals of each species evaluated for the % of leaf area injured (amount) and severity of injury using a 5 scale rating system; and dogbane added as a bioindicator.

    • Unnamed Method
      • Started: 1995-08-01
      • Method Description: Pin cherry added as a bioindicator species in 1995.

    • Unnamed Method
      • Started: 1996-08-01
      • Method Description: Definition of amount of injury changed from % of leaf area to % of leaves with injury in 1996.

    • Ozone concentrations
      • Method Description: One-hour average ozone concentrations recorded were obtained from the Vermont Air Pollution Control Agency.

    • Classification and rating of injured foliage
      • Method Description: Classification/Rating methods of injured foliage: (1) A five class system- combines the percentage of injured leaves and the intensity of damage on the 10 most severely injured leaves. (2) An eight class system- rates 30 leaves on each of three terminal shoots from near the top of a tree, or the oldest 30 leaves on a smaller plant.


  • Past Methods (no longer in use)
    • Individual condition
      • Started: 1994-08-01
        Ended: 1995-08-31
      • Method Description: The location and type of injury recorded for each individual.

Site Characteristics

  • Site Description: West slope of Mt. Mansfield, open field at Proctor Maple Research Center. Sampling done in areas not mowed during current year.



  • Site Description: In 1999 added CASTNet air quality station site to represent the Lye Brook Wilderness Area. Large open field with moist soil. Plants present include: pin cherry, blackberry, black cherry.
